Transaction 30643570cffd55cd5e8409bbd65e197fe87535bfe79605c382ac96b4eccb7f8a
1 Input
1 Output
-
30643570cffd55cd5e8409bbd65e197fe87535bfe79605c382ac96b4eccb7f8a:0
- value
- 18266717
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d825ce7238902185618b475044f0bf3ddc49de97 OP_EQUALVERIFY OP_CHECKSIG
- address
- LevqWV6XT6NMM7gEfAxbeTUaKyYjJNS1BV